Understanding Interest Rates and Loan Terms
Ever wondered why interest rates and loan terms seem as be the secret sauce for your bed and breakfast financing? Understanding them can feel like deciphering a menu in a foreign language! The right interest rate and loan terms can tailor fit your financial strategy.
Here’s a quick overview about what you might expect:
Loan Type | Interest Rate Range | Loan Term Length |
---|---|---|
SBA 504 Loans | ~5% | Up through 25 years |
Bank Small Loans | 6.54% through 11.7% | 1 through 10 years |
Online Term Loans | 14% through 99% | Short through long-term |
Whether you opt for a fixed-rate or variable-rate loan, your credit score and risk assessment play huge roles in determining loan affordability and repayment schedules. Key Eligibility Considerations for Bed and Breakfast Loans
When you’re gearing up so as to apply for a bed and breakfast loan, understanding the eligibility considerations is like preparing a recipe—you need the right ingredients so as to make that work. Here’s a quick overview:
Consideration | Details |
---|---|
Business Viability | Must be an operating, profitable B&B for at least a year. |
Creditworthiness | Aim for a credit score at 650+ in order to boost loan approval chances. |
Financial Stability | Show monthly revenues ideally over $20,000 in order to prove you can repay the loan! |

What Types of Collateral Are Acceptable for B&B Loans?
For B&B loans, you can use various assets as collateral, like your property, equipment, or accounts receivable. Strengthen your application by showcasing significant personal assets and a solid business plan in order to boost your appeal.
